Road Signs

 

The Highway Authority provides signs in order to give information to the road user.

All signs on the highway must be authorised by the authority. Special signs are allowed with prior approval of the Department for Transport, or if they are experimental and under trial.

 

Tourism Signing

Tourism Signing provides an important opportunity for both tourism businesses and local economies and will be implemented positively and constructively.

 

There is of course an advertising element as it helps to generate more impromptu visits. However the primary purpose is to safely guide those wishing to visit a tourist destination along the most appropriate route for the latter stages of their journey, or to indicate facilities that a tourist would not reasonably expect to find in that location.
